Songs of the Summer 2024 contenders

The race for the UK's Official Song of the Summer 2024 has begun!

Here at Official Charts, we're always looking forward to the time of year where the days get longer and hotter, and we're always on the lookout for the song that's going to be the soundtrack of any given summer.

Last year, Central Cee & Dave's record-breaking smash Sprinter was named 2023's Official Song of the Summer - but what will be 2024's? Here are our picks for the contenders to keep an eye on!

Dance tunes

cassö, Jazzy & Headie One – Zeros

cassö, coming off his Number 2 smash Prada with RAYE and D-Block Europe, has teamed up with experienced dance vocalist Jazzy and rapper Headie One on Zeros, co-written by Clementine Douglas.

Disclosure – She’s Gone, Dance On

More than a decade since their debut album, Settle, changed British dance music forever, Disclosure are back, this time with a summer jam that contains an intelligent sample of Italian composer Ennio Morricone's Dance On with Michael Fraser.

Majestic, The Jammin Kid & Céline Dion – Set My Heart On Fire (I’m Alive x And The Beat Goes On)

Céline Dion is nothing if not a fighter, as a new documentary on her life and current battle with Stiff Person Syndrome (SPS) arrives on Amazon Prime Video, it makes sense one of her most jubliant hits, I'm Alive, has received a mashup makeover by the DJ Majestic.

The Blessed Madonna & Clementine Douglas – Happier

Already the first UK Top 20 hit for acclaimed DJ and producer The Blessed Madonna, can Happier stick around in the sunshine?

Ella Henderson, Switch Disco & Alok – Under The Sun

10 years since Ghost debuted at Number 1, and Ella Henderson has become one of the UK's premier dancefloor divas.

Flex (UK) ft. Nate Dogg – 6 In The Morning

A recent new entry in the UK Top 40, Flex's banging new tune features vocals from late rapper Nate Dogg, who died in 2011.

PAWSA ft. Nate Dogg – PICK UP THE PHONE

It doesn't stop there. Could Nate Dogg pick up a second posthumous hit this summer?

Zerb, The Chainsmokers & Ink – Addicted

The Chainsmokers broke through with hits including Closer with Halsey, but haven't seriously bothered the charts in a while. Could this set them back on top?

Kabin Crew & Lisdoonvarna Crew – The Spark

Originally conceived in sessions for a non-profit youth rap in Cork City, Kabin Crew & Lisdoonvarna Crew's members are all schoolkids aged 9-12, but that hasn't stopped them going massively viral. The Derry Girls would be proud.

Girl On Couch & Billen Ted – Man In Finance (G6 Trust Fund)

Looking for a man in finance? Trust fund? 6'5? Blue eyes? Us too!

This viral moment stemming from a nine-second TikTok by Megan Boni, aka Girl on Couch, asking "Did I just write the song of the summer? Can someone make this into an actual song plz just for funzies" has lead to an actual song being made by Billen Ted (and a remix by David Guetta!) Time will tell if it becomes the song of the summer...

Fred again.., Anderson .Paak & CHIKA – places to be

Taken from Fred again..'s latest ongoing project USB, places to be is shaping up to be another hit for the Mercury Prize-nominated star.

Sonny Fodera ft. blythe – Mind Still

Following his Top 10 hit Asking with Clementine Douglas and MK, Australian DJ Sonny Fodera is hoping lightning will strike twice.

Future hits

Katy Perry – Woman’s World

After a few years in the pop wilderness, Katy's big mainstream comeback is upon us. Woman's World arrives with a world of expectations on its cyborg shoulders, as it seeks to put one of the biggest pop stars of all time back on top.

Charli xcx – 360

Do you like what you see? Charli's IT girl anthem is the name on everyone's lips after BRAT's release.

Tinashe - Nasty

Tinashe is looking for someone to match her freak on her biggest hit in years - will the UK answer?

Gracie Abrams - Close To You

Gracie secured her first-ever UK Top 40 single with this infectious slice of Lorde-inspired synth pop. Read more in our interview with Gracie Abrams here.

Perrie - Tears

Perrie's '80s-inspired breezy bop has chilled summer evening written all over it, tbh.

JADE - Angel Of My Dreams

Can Little Mix's Jade Thirlwall deliver with her debut solo offering?

GloRilla - TGIF

Bringing the heat, US rapper GloRilla's snippets of her new track TGIF keep going extremely viral, a big hint this is a future hit to keep an eye on!

Country takeover

Shaboozey – A Bar Song (Tipsy)

Someone pour him a double shot of whiskey! Shaboozey's Top 10 smash is not going anywhere.

Post Malone & Morgan Wallen – I Had Some Help / Post Malone & Blake Shelton – Pour Me A Drink

With a brand new country-focused album F-1 Trillion on the way, there's not stopping Post Malone right now.

Zach Bryan – Pink Skies

US country superstar Zach Bryan has already scored one UK hit with I Remember Everything with Kacey Musgraves - can he get another?

Kane Brown & Marshmello – Miles On It

Another ascendant star over the pond, Kane Brown's team-up with Marshmello is country with a heavy injection of dance.

Moneybagg Yo & Morgan Wallen – WHISKEY WHISKEY

Probably the biggest artist in his native US (Taylor Swift aside, of course), Morgan Wallen has another collaboration catching heat, with Memphis MC Moneybagg Yo.

Afrobeats bangers

Byron Messia, Lil Baby & Rvssian – Choppa

The brains behind 2023 Top 20 hit Talibans, Choppa sees Byron Messia team up with Lil Baby and Jamaican producer Rvssian.

Tems – Love Me JeJe

The heart-swooning Love Me JeJe has ruled the Number 1 spot on the Official Afrobeats Chart for weeks, and isn't going anywhere anytime soon.

Tyla - ART/Jump ft. Gunna & Skillibeng

Tyla is perhaps THE breakout Afrobeats artist of the moment. Her self-titled debut album is full of hits, but the two biggest smashes still waiting for their time to shine are ART and Jump with Gunna and Skillibeng.

Rema - Benin Boys

Rema's first new single of the year sees him reclaim his place as one of the most popular and exciting artists working in Afrobeats right now.

Current chart smashes

Sabrina Carpenter - Espresso

What is there to say about that me Espresso that hasn't already been said (by us)?

Chappell Roan - Good Luck, Babe!

Chappell Roan's long-awaited breakout moment is quite something to behold; a sapphic lament that's one part Marina, one part Kate Bush and one part medieval renaissance fair.

Benson Boone - Slow It Down

Scoring his first Number 1 this year with Beautiful Things, Slow It Down is Benson's elegant follow-up.

Sabrina Carpenter - Please Please Please

Ask nicely and Sabrina Carpenter may just have another irresistible (and inescapable) summer smash for you...

Myles Smith - Stargazing

Thanks to the rollicking Stargazing, Myles Smith now has his first UK Top 10 single...and a shot at song of the summer.

Eminem - Houdini

Catch him or he goes! Eminem's 11th Number 1 single on the Official Chart is a return to form for Slim Shady.

Billie Eilish – BIRDS OF A FEATHER

HIT ME HARD AND SOFT is the most experimental (and honest) LP of Billie's career so far, and the soaring BIRDS OF A FEATHER is one of its biggest breakout hits.

Central Cee & Lil Baby – BAND4BAND

The latest single from Central Cee's forthcoming debut album, Band4Band earned a debut straight into the Top 10.

Comeback corner?

Bronski Beat – Smalltown Boy

Featured in the TV hit everyone is still talking about - Netflix's Baby Reindeer - this 1984 single from queer synth-pop triro Bronski Beat celebrates its 40th anniversary this year (yes, 00s kids, that is the sample from September's club classic Cry For You).

Disturbed – The Sound Of Silence (CYRIL Remix)

Disturbed's morose cover of the Simon & Garfunkel classic has got a snazzy new CYRIL remix which finds it climbing the charts once more.

Badger & Natasha Bedingfield – These Words

Not content with having one career resurgence this year, Natasha Bedingfield's 2004 Number 1 (all about overcoming writer's block) has been re-imagined by DJ Badger.
